Not to be confused with its commercial pendant that has the same name. It allows you to parse, analyze, and convert PDF documents. Pdflib for Python: An extension of the Poppler Library that offers Python bindings for it. It also enables you to convert a PDF file into a CSV/TSV/JSON file. Tabula-py: It is a simple Python wrapper of tabula-java, which can read tables from PDFs and convert them into Pandas DataFrames. Its design aim is "to reliably extract data from sets of PDFs with as little code as possible." PDFQuery: It describes itself as "a fast and friendly PDF scraping library" which is implemented as a wrapper around PDFMiner, lxml, and pyquery.

This includes the support for PDF 1.7 as well as CJK languages (Chinese, Japanese, and Korean), and various font types (Type1, TrueType, Type3, and CID). Both packages allow you to parse, analyze, and convert PDF documents. For Python 3, use the cloned package PDFMiner.six. PDFMiner: Is written entirely in Python, and works well for Python 2.4. PyPDF2 supports both unencrypted and encrypted documents. PyPDF2: A Python library to extract document information and content, split documents page-by-page, merge documents, crop pages, and add watermarks.
